Not sure there was a bit of jumbled code that made me think cats charm and bear claw both had effects, but I couldn't figure out if and what they did. The succubus was a bit more plain so that one is confirmed.
The others might also be a restriction making it impossible to seduce if the wrong item is used, now that I come to think about it. To get a definite answer you'll have to ask JK.
If they have effects they work for female and male seducers respectively.

Mages who lose some of their magic paths when leaving the water (Oceana primarily) apparently have this functionality tied to their unit type, so you can circumvent this by casting transformation, twiceborn, etc.
